This list contains only the countries for which job offers have been published in the selected language (e.g., in the French version, only job offers written in French are displayed, and in the English version, only those in English).
As Director of Business Development (DBD), you will drive new client acquisition, grow the agency pipeline, and win new logos across Amsive’s digital solutions—performance media, SEO, content and creative, analytics, and full-funnel audience-driven marketing. Our ideal candidate will be a confident, consultative seller with the ability to shape a pitch, articulate digital strategy, and lead insight-driven conversations with senior marketing decision makers. This role requires strong data storytelling skills and the ability to translate insights into clear recommendations that highlight how Amsive’s solutions improve performance and business outcomes. This is an individual contributor role with full ownership of pipeline creation and deal progression.
Job Responsibility:
Drive new-logo growth by targeting and engaging senior marketing leaders at enterprise and high-growth brands
Prospect strategic accounts, manage inbound opportunities, and collaborate with subject-matter experts to deliver compelling proposals and presentations
Develop and execute prioritized outbound strategies supported by ongoing research, market intelligence, and a deep understanding of digital trends
Lead consultative discovery conversations that uncover business challenges and translate them into actionable strategies across performance media, SEO, social, content, creative, and analytics
Own the full pitch and proposal cycle—from shaping the strategic approach and coordinating SMEs to delivering persuasive, insight-driven presentations
Collaborate with channel leaders and subject-matter experts to develop integrated, cross-channel solutions and enterprise-ready scopes of work
Create compelling sales narratives, pitch decks, and proposals that clearly articulate Amsive’s value, approach, and points of differentiation
Qualify inbound leads using a strategic fit-based approach, ensuring long-term value alignment rather than transactional selling
Partner with the SVP of Sales, Marketing, and Sales Enablement to refine targeting, strengthen competitive positioning, and support demand-generation initiatives
Stay current on digital innovation, competitive shifts, and evolving client needs to proactively identify and shape new opportunities
Maintain disciplined pipeline management, forecasting, and CRM hygiene to ensure visibility and accountability across leadership
Represent Amsive at industry events, conferences, and speaking engagements to build presence and accelerate opportunity creation
Collaborate with internal teams during onboarding to ensure smooth handoff and support strategic business reviews when appropriate
Requirements:
10+ years in sales or business development, with 5+ years in a digital or performance marketing agency
Proven success selling multi-channel digital solutions to enterprise or high-growth brands
Strong understanding of paid media, SEO, social, content, creative strategy, analytics, and adtech ecosystem
Excellent communication and presentation skills, including executive-level pitch experience
Strong analytical mindset and ability to interpret data to shape recommendations
Disciplined pipeline management, forecasting, and CRM proficiency
Demonstrated ability to collaborate with cross-functional SMEs and manage deals end-to-end
Welcome to CrawlJobs.com – Your Global Job Discovery Platform
At CrawlJobs.com, we simplify finding your next career opportunity by bringing job listings directly to you from all corners of the web. Using cutting-edge AI and web-crawling technologies, we gather and curate job offers from various sources across the globe, ensuring you have access to the most up-to-date job listings in one place.
We use cookies to enhance your experience, analyze traffic, and serve personalized content. By clicking “Accept”, you agree to the use of cookies.